The Red Conspiracy examines the ideologies of Socialism, Bolshevism, Communism, and I.W.W.'ism to argue against their adoption in the United States. The author asserts that these radical programs pose a threat to the nation's constitutional government and warns that they would ultimately increase the suffering of the American working class.
